Output 7e58b51af068160e7ff530ea8582ee7ae94fe55fa73b7431d4add91ea488b5cd:6

value
74539512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 046f0f444d13490c021e0c1d378e44e493f6d859 OP_EQUAL
address
M8JbykpRweZHonnETw1auUUufc7A8KACpQ
transaction
7e58b51af068160e7ff530ea8582ee7ae94fe55fa73b7431d4add91ea488b5cd
spent
true